Output 704da429c61e192a0f4db27b7e67a36adb3d8507e276c55345061c3cfd2cf0ab:3

value
11764215
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b1340576481e1779df40ee33e76d8b3d64e359957ebe9e5655afc3defff5f6b8
address
tb1pky6q2ajgrcthnh6qace7wmvt84jwxkv406lfu4j44lpaall476uqxmf4y2
transaction
704da429c61e192a0f4db27b7e67a36adb3d8507e276c55345061c3cfd2cf0ab